StoneMood CX pairs a calm natural stone face with an unusually wide size run: 2x2 mosaic, 24x24, 24x48, 32x32, 32x64 and a 48x110 panel. Colours are Silver, Beige and Grey, all matte, all with non-repeating faces, which makes it a strong candidate when one material has to cover many different surfaces.
Field sizes come in 8mm glazed porcelain with the large panel in a 6mm profile, and none of it needs sealing. The matte finish is comfortable in wet rooms, and the scale options fit everything from a Metro Vancouver ensuite to a commercial lobby, letting floors, walls and shower pans stay in the same quiet stone.

Where StoneMood CX Works
Multi-surface bathrooms
One collection covers the shower pan in mosaic, the floor in 24x24 and the walls in 32x64 or panel format, keeping colour and pattern consistent throughout.
Large format floors
The 32 x 32 and 32 x 64 sizes offer a middle path: bigger presence than standard tile, easier handling than full panels, well suited to open-plan main floors.
Panel feature walls
At 48 x 110, two panels can clad a fireplace or shower wall almost joint-free, and the 6mm profile keeps handling and weight sensible on vertical surfaces.
Quiet commercial interiors
Lobbies, corridors and building washrooms benefit from the muted stone face, matte durability and the ability to scale the tile size to each area within one specification.
Design Notes
Pairing & Layout Ideas
The palette is soft, so StoneMood CX flatters nearly anything: warm oak vanities, painted cabinetry, chrome or brass. Beige carries a warmer scheme; Silver and Grey suit cooler, gallery-like rooms. Tone-matched grout preserves the monolithic effect the big sizes create. Its closest sibling is Masterstone CX, which offers a similar size range with polished options, so compare the two together if you are undecided on sheen.

StoneMood CX Questions
Why so many sizes?
So one stone can serve a whole project. Showers want mosaics, floors want mid-to-large formats, and feature walls want panels; StoneMood CX supplies all of them with matching colour and faces, avoiding the compromise of pairing near-miss tiles from two different collections.
Is matte the only finish?
Yes, StoneMood CX is matte across all sizes and colours. That keeps it practical for wet floors and gives the whole collection a soft, natural sheen. If you want a similar broad size range with polished finishes available, Masterstone CX is the collection to look at.
What should my installer know about the 48x110 panels?
They are 6mm porcelain panels, so they need flat substrates, large-format setting materials and two sets of hands. An installer experienced with gauged porcelain panels will be comfortable with them. Which colour hides everyday dirt well?
Beige and Silver are the forgiving mid-tones, showing less dust than a dark tile and fewer marks than a bright white. Grey is close behind. The matte finish helps too, since it does not highlight smudges or water spots the way a polished surface can.
